static public void LoadXml_OtionsView(PivotGridControl pivotGrid, DataSet ds) { DataTable dt = ds.Tables[TableName]; if (dt == null) { return; } foreach (DataRow row in dt.Rows) { string sPropertieName = row.GetString(PropertieName); string sChecked = row.GetString(Checked); SetOptions.SetOptionValueByString(sPropertieName, pivotGrid.OptionsView, Convert.ToBoolean(sChecked)); } }
protected virtual void ApplyOptions(bool setOptions) { if (LockApply != 0) { return; } for (int i = 0; i < PrintFlags.Length; i++) { CheckEdit chb = CheckEditByIndex(i); if (chb != null) { SetOptions.SetOptionValueByString(PrintFlags[i], setOptions ? EditingView.OptionsPrint : CurrentView.OptionsPrint, chb.Checked); } } EditingView.FireChangedInternal(); }